Sale Quick view Add to Cart SRAM BRAKE PART SRAM TACKLEBOX GUIDE SPARE PARTS 11.5018.035.000 $184.43 $177.10 $289.00 SRAM
Sale Quick view Add to Cart SRAM, Guide Spare Parts Tackle Box, 11.5018.035.000 $289.00 $261.99 $289.00 SRAM
Sale Out of stock Quick view Out of stock SRAM, 11.7618.004.000, Red eTap, Front derailleur spare parts kit $42.00 $31.43 $42.00 SRAM
Sale Out of stock Quick view Out of stock HYDRATION HEALTH FOOD HYDRATION HEALTH MIX PREPLAY PACKETS BXof25 RASPBERRY LEMONADE 35790 $63.53 $51.24 HYDRATION HEALTH